FAQs: Best Dubai Brunches

What time do Dubai brunches usually run?
Most start between 12:30–1:30 pm and run 3–4 hours. Evening “drunch” deals are common on Thu–Sat.

Which areas are best for brunch—Marina, Palm, or DIFC?
Marina = views + variety; Palm = beachy, resort vibes; DIFC = sleek, DJ-led, pricier.

How much should I budget?
Rough guide per person: food-only AED 120–250; house drinks AED 250–450; premium bubbles AED 450–750+.

Do I need to book ahead?
Yes—1–2 weeks for popular Saturday slots, longer in peak season (Oct–Apr) and holidays.

Is alcohol served at all brunches?
Licensed hotel/restaurant venues serve alcohol; packages vary (soft, house, premium). Bring valid ID.

Are kids welcome?
Many hotel brunches are family-friendly (some include kids’ activities). Check age pricing and high chair availability.

What’s the dress code?
Smart-casual works almost everywhere. DIFC can skew dressy; beach venues welcome resort wear (no swimwear inside).

Any good options for halal, vegan, or gluten-free?
Yes—most hotel brunches label allergens and can adapt on request. Confirm when booking.

Do brunches run during Ramadan?
Yes, but hours, music, and service style may change. Always check venue updates.

Parking and transport tips?
Hotels usually offer valet or validated parking. For Marina/Palm, consider taxis or the tram/monorail on busy weekends.

What’s the tipping norm?
Service charge is often included; if not, 5–10% for great service is appreciated.
